Transaction 2eca47c8770f677b111b9957928ea543a6366384404655abaed31f6e2823b06e
1 Input
2 Outputs
- 2eca47c8770f677b111b9957928ea543a6366384404655abaed31f6e2823b06e:0
- 2eca47c8770f677b111b9957928ea543a6366384404655abaed31f6e2823b06e:1
value 378424
address 3Hd9JSRo99Dky7XybjJESZg6GfnZvSeFyW
value 2749324
address 15JWHYaVQfcEmcXCEravHgJemGBAwgsjtw